Lenovo Z5 Pro features a 6.39-inch touchscreen display with a resolution of 1080×2340 pixels. It is being powered by an octa-core Qualcomm Snapdragon 855  processor coupled with 6GB of RAM and 128 GB of onboard storage that can be expanded via microSD card (up to 256GB).

Lenovo Z5 Pro GT sports a 16-megapixel primary camera and a second 24-megapixel camera on the rear side. On the front, Lenovo Z5 Pro GT has 16MP + 8MP dual camera set up. Lenovo Z5 Pro GT runs ZUI 10 based on Android 9.0 Pie and packs a 3350mAh non-removable battery. The device has received the official Android 10.0 update as well. Method -2: Using QPST Tool

  • First of all, make sure you have followed each and every step mentioned in the pre-requisites section and download the QPST File.

After downloading, you will find two files Qualcomm_USB_Drivers_For_Windows.rar and QPST.WIN.2.7 Installer-00429.zip

  • Open the QPST Win folder then Install the QPST.exe on your windows
  • Once it is installed, go to the Installed Location on the Main Drive (C)
  • Open the QPST Configuration, Click on Add new port -> Select the com port of your device -> and close it 
  • After that Open the EMMC Software Downloader in the same folder located all the QPST Files
  • In EMMC Software Downloader, Check program bootloaders -> Browse for the device com port
  • Now Click Load XML Def and browse for rawprogram0.xml in folder ROM in EMMC Software Downloader (make sure you have extracted the ROM Zip file)
  • Click On Load Patch def and browse for patch0.xml in folder ROM
  • Check the search path 2 and browse for the folder ROM
  • After all this click download, wait for the download to finish (it will find a new driver, install that)
  • Now, wait for the process to finish. Once it is done, remove your device from PC and you have installed Stock ROM on Lenovo Z5 Pro.
